Meaning & usage

noun
  1. A line of electricity transmission towers, usually in groups, cutting across a city.

    Canada
  2. The undeveloped land under those towers.

    Canada
Where this word comes from

Canadian English, from hydro + field. In Canadian English, the word "hydro" can refer to any electricity, regardless of how it was generated.
